[Detailed Description of the Invention] The present invention relates to a wariko of a bamboo sword (shinai), and in particular,
This invention relates to a splitter having excellent impact resistance in the height direction of the splitter.

As the name suggests, shinai are made from natural bamboo material, but the drawback of bamboo shinai is that they are particularly weak against impact. As a result, hangnails, cracks, splits, etc. may occur on the wariko of the shinai during use.
In some cases, breakage has caused bodily injury accidents.

In order to solve these problems, Shinai warikos made of various composite materials have been developed. Some bamboo swords made of composite materials can almost solve the problem of durability against impact, but unfortunately they are hardly ever used. The biggest reason for this is that the weight of a shinai made from composite materials is much greater than that of a regular bamboo shinai, and the actual feeling of use is completely different from that of a bamboo shinai. be.

Therefore, there is a need for the development of a composite shinai that is lightweight and has impact resistance so that the feeling in actual use is almost the same as that of a natural bamboo shinai.

When practicing or competing in kendo with a shinai, each wariko of the shinai receives an impact load from the opponent's shinai on the surface of the wariko, and at the same time receives an impact load on the side of the wariko.

The shinai of the present invention particularly increases the strength against impact acting on the surface of the wariko.

That is, in order to increase the bending rigidity of the shinai, a box-shaped reinforcing member is provided, and at the same time, fibers are added to the area within the box-shaped reinforcing member so that the direction of the fibers extends in the height direction (vertical direction) of the wariko. By arranging the material, even when impact force is applied to the surface of the splitter, the reinforcing member remains in the vertical direction (height direction).
This prevents the steel from becoming distorted, thereby improving impact resistance.

In addition, "box shape" used in this invention
This term refers not only to shapes that form a complete closed rectangle as shown in the figure, but also to shapes that have slight gaps at any of the four corners or sides, and shapes that are slightly curved on any side. This also includes those with a shape that is

FIG. 1 is a perspective view of a shinai 10, and normally the shinai 10 is composed of four splits 12.

FIG. 2 is a cross-sectional view showing a schematic structure of the warp 12 of the bamboo sword of the present invention. A surface protection material 16, a side surface protection material 18, and a back surface material 20 are provided. The box-shaped reinforcing member has a substantially rectangular cross-sectional shape on both its inner and outer surfaces. In addition, a region 22 surrounded by the reinforcing member 14
is provided with a core made of a fibrous material having a configuration as described below. Although the surface protection material 16, side protection material 18, and back surface material 20 are not directly related to the present invention, various plastics, wood, rubber, etc. may be used as appropriate from the viewpoint of strength and lightness. can.

FIG. 3 shows a box-shaped reinforcing member 14, which is a feature of the present invention, and a core 2 provided in a region 22 (FIG. 2) surrounded by this reinforcing member 14.
6 shows various configuration examples. Reinforcement member 14
can be made from lightweight materials with excellent tensile strength, such as fiber-reinforced plastic (FRP) or lightweight metal sheets.
It is preferable to use FRP such as carbon fiber or glass fiber in terms of adhesion with 8 and 20 and ease of molding. The core body 26 is made of a fibrous material such as wood, bamboo, or FRP.

FIG. 3a shows a region 22 surrounded by the reinforcing member 14.
A core body 26 made of a fibrous material is present throughout the interior. The fibers 28 of the core body 26 extend in the height direction (vertical direction) of the splitter. Figure 3b is
A core body 26 of a fibrous material (for example, wood, bamboo, FRP, etc.) with fibers extending in the height direction of the splitter is present in a part of the region 22 surrounded by the reinforcing member 14,
At the same time, in another part of the region 22, there is shown an example in which a fibrous material or a material 30 other than the fibrous material exists, the fibers of which extend in a direction other than the height direction of the splitter. By using a lightweight material such as low-magnification foamed plastic as the material 30 other than the fibrous material, the adhesion to the box-shaped reinforcing member 14 can be improved, and the impact resistance of the surface of the splitter can be further improved. can be increased.

The box-shaped reinforcing member 14 is preferably provided over the entire length of the splitter 12 in the longitudinal direction in order to increase the bending rigidity of the splitter 12. It may be provided only in a certain length portion near the tip of the splitter, or the portion other than the necessary portion may not be box-shaped. Also,
Even when the reinforcing member 14 is provided over the entire length of the splitter, by providing only the core body 26 only in a certain length portion near the tip of the splitter,
The weight of the entire warizo can be further reduced.

As described above, since the warts of the present invention are provided with the reinforcing member 14 having a box structure, the bending rigidity of the warts can be increased, and the warts are made of a fibrous material in which fibers extend in the height direction of the warts. Since the core body 26 is provided, the impact force acting on the surface of the splitter is absorbed by the core body 26.
This prevents the box-shaped reinforcing member 14 from deforming and prevents the surface protection layer 16 from denting, cracking, or tearing.
